Green Leaves Early Learning Centres in the City of Westminster is seeking a Lead Educator to transform learning into an exciting journey. You will mentor a team of Educators while focusing on the image of the child. Responsibilities include guiding staff and participating in a range of professional development opportunities.

The role offers flexible shifts, competitive pay, and extensive perks including a childcare discount and wellness programs.

How to prepare for a job interview at Green Leaves Early Learning Centres

Know Your Educational Philosophy

Before the interview, take some time to reflect on your educational philosophy and how it aligns with the values of Green Leaves Early Learning Centres. Be ready to discuss how you view the image of the child and how that influences your mentoring style.

Showcase Your Mentoring Experience

Prepare specific examples of how you've successfully mentored others in the past. Highlight any professional development initiatives you've led or participated in, as this will demonstrate your commitment to growth and collaboration within a team.

Engage with Their Vision

Research Green Leaves Early Learning Centres and understand their mission and vision. During the interview, express how you can contribute to transforming learning into an exciting journey for both children and educators, showing that you're genuinely interested in their approach.

Ask Thoughtful Questions

Prepare insightful questions about the role and the team dynamics. Inquire about the professional development opportunities available and how they support their educators. This shows your enthusiasm for the position and your desire to grow within the organisation.
